A Number Theoretical Observation about the Degeneracy of the Genetic Code

We discuss the similarity of the degeneration structure of the genetic code with a purely number theoretic “divisors code.” The most interesting thing about our observation is not that there is a connection between number theory and the genetic code, but the simplicity of the rule. We hope that the observation and the naive model presented in this paper will spur ideas for other models of the degeneracy of the genetic code. Maybe, the ideas of this article can also be used in the area of artificial life to synthesize artificial genetic codes.
